凸集的一个证明

本文通过数学归纳法证明了凸集的性质,具体展示了如何利用凸集的定义来证明其对于任意数量点的线性组合仍位于该集合内部。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

凸集的定义
对集合 SSS 任意两点 x1x_1x1x2x_2x2,以及两个实数 θ1\theta_1θ1θ2\theta_2θ2,并且 θ1+θ2=1\theta_1+\theta_2=1θ1+θ2=1θ1≥0\theta_1\geq 0θ10θ2≥0\theta_2\geq 0θ20,都有
θ1x1+θ2x2∈S\theta_1 x_1+\theta_2x_2\in Sθ1x1+θ2x2S
SSS 是凸集。


问题:
集合 SSS 是凸集,证明对其中任意 kkk 个点 x1…xkx_1\dots x_kx1xk,以及 kkk 个实数 θ1…θk\theta_1\dots \theta_kθ1θk,并且 θ1+⋯+θk=1\theta_1+\dots+\theta_k=1θ1++θk=1θ1≥0,…,θk≥0\theta_1\geq 0,\dots ,\theta_k\geq 0θ10,,θk0,都有
θ1x1+θ2x2+⋯+θkxk∈S\theta_1 x_1+\theta_2x_2+\dots+\theta_kx_k\in Sθ1x1+θ2x2++θkxkS


证明:
数学归纳法。对于 k=2k=2k=2 时,显然成立。
假设对于 k=nk=nk=n 时成立,下面我们证明 k=n+1k=n+1k=n+1 时也成立。
θ1x1+θ2x2+⋯+θk+1xk+1=θ1x1+(1−θ1)(θ21−θ1x2+⋯+θk+11−θ1xk+1) \begin{aligned} &\theta_1 x_1+\theta_2x_2+\dots+\theta_{k+1}x_{k+1}\\ =&\theta_1 x_1+(1-\theta_1)\left(\frac{\theta_2}{1-\theta_1 }x_2+\dots+\frac{\theta_{k+1}}{1-\theta_1}x_{k+1} \right) \end{aligned} =θ1x1+θ2x2++θk+1xk+1θ1x1+(1θ1)(1θ1θ2x2++1θ1θk+1xk+1)

因为 θ21−θ1+⋯+θk+11−θ1=1−θ11−θ1=1\frac{\theta_2}{1-\theta_1 }+\dots+\frac{\theta_{k+1}}{1-\theta_1 }=\frac{1-\theta_1}{1-\theta_1}=11θ1θ2++1θ1θk+1=1θ11θ1=1,根据 k=nk=nk=n 时成立,上式第二项在凸集 SSS 中,第一项与第二项的和相当于 k=2k=2k=2 的情况,故也在凸集 SSS 中。□\quad\Box

<think>好的,用户想了解投影算法的实现和原理。我需要先回顾一下已有的知识,特别是引用中的相关内容。用户提供的引用里有关于投影算法的基础理论、执行步骤、应用场景以及Python实现的例子,这应该能帮助我构建一个全面的回答。 首先,根据引用[3],投影算法(POCS)的核心是在矢量空间中定义闭合的约束,然后通过迭代投影到这些合的交来逼近解。算法包括运动估计、初始估计生成、迭代投影和约束应用等步骤。需要详细解释这些步骤,并说明其数学原理,比如投影算子的作用。 接下来,原理部分需要强调的定义和投影定理,可能涉及数学表达式,比如投影到的操作。根据系统指令,数学表达式要用$...$格式,例如投影算子$P_C(x)$的定义。此外,引用[1]提到的POCS定理和算法8.1可能相关,需要提及松弛投影算子的使用,以说明收敛性。实现部分需要结合引用[3]中的执行过程,分步骤说明,可能包括运动估计的逐级处理、初始估计的选择、迭代投影的具体操作(如残余项计算和反投影)。同时,引用[4]提到了Python实现的示例,虽然用户的问题可能不要求代码,但可以简要说明实现的关键点,如使用NumPy进行矩阵运算和迭代过程。要注意用户可能需要区分原理和实现,所以结构上先讲原理再讲实现步骤会比较清晰。同时,用户可能对算法的应用场景和优势感兴趣,可以引用[2]提到的数据分析中的聚类应用,以及图像处理中的例子,如引用[3]中的运动估计和高分辨率图像重建。另外,用户可能对为什么投影有效感兴趣,需要解释的性质和投影的收敛性,引用[1]中的定理支持这一点。同时,可能存在的优化方法或停止准则也需要提及,如引用[3]中的步骤7提到的停止条件。最后,生成相关问题时要围绕算法原理、实现细节、应用案例和优化方法,比如收敛性证明、参数影响、与其他算法的比较等。要确保问题能够引导用户进一步深入学习。 需要检查是否有遗漏的关键点,比如的定义、投影算子的数学表达、迭代过程的收敛性,以及实际应用中的处理步骤。确保回答符合系统指令,正确使用LaTeX格式,结构清晰,分点阐述,并自然添加引用标识。</think>### 投影算法(POCS)的原理与实现 #### 一、核心原理 1. **定义与投影定理** 投影算法(Projection onto Convex Sets, POCS)基于一个关键假设:待求解问题可表示为多个闭合的交。每个对应一种约束条件(如数据一致性、幅度限制等)。若存在解,则解位于这些的交中。 投影操作定义为:对任意点$x$,其在$C$上的投影$P_C(x)$是$C$中离$x$最近的点,即 $$P_C(x) = \arg\min_{y \in C} \|x - y\|$$ 通过交替投影到各个,算法逐步逼近交内的解[^1]。 2. **松弛投影与收敛性** 实际应用中,常引入松弛因子$\lambda \in (0,2)$以加速收敛,投影算子变为: $$P_{C,\lambda}(x) = x + \lambda (P_C(x) - x)$$ 根据POCS定理,在有限个闭且交非空时,迭代过程必定收敛[^1][^3]。 #### 二、实现步骤(以图像超分辨率重建为例[^3]) 1. **运动估计与初始化** - **分级块匹配**:通过多级高斯滤波和插值,逐级提升运动矢量精度。 - **初始估计生成**:选择参考帧,对低分辨率图像插值后运动补偿,生成初始高分辨率估计$z_0^{(k)}$。 2. **迭代投影过程** ```plaintext for 迭代次数 t in 1,2,...: for 每个约束合 G_l(i,j): a. 计算残余项 r_{lt}(i,j) = y_l(i,j) - A_l^{(k)}z_t^{(k)} b. 反投影修正:z_{t+1} = z_t + λ * A_l^{(k)T} r_{lt}(i,j) c. 应用幅度约束(如非负性) d. 检查收敛条件(如残差变化率) ``` 3. **关键约束类型** - **数据一致性约束**:确保重建图像与观测数据匹配,如$y = Az + \eta$($A$为模糊矩阵,$\eta$为噪声)。 - **幅度约束**:限制像素值范围(如$0 \leq z \leq 255$)。 - **运动一致性约束**:通过运动补偿保证多帧对齐[^3]。 #### 三、应用场景与优势 1. **图像重建**:如超分辨率、去模糊、医学成像,通过多帧数据融合提升分辨率。 2. **信号处理**:解决欠定线性方程组,如压缩感知重建。 3. **聚类分析**:将数据点投影到以划分簇,如引用[2]中的投影聚类算法。 **优势**:对噪声鲁棒、可灵活成多种先验知识,且理论收敛性明确[^1][^4]。 ---
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

心态与习惯

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值